

Often, both Landlords and Tenants choose to save copies of rent receipts for these reasons.Landlords are required to provide tenants with a rent receipt for cash payments only. For Tenants who pay their rent in cash, a rent receipt is often the only written proof they have showing that they paid rent at all. A Rent Receipt can be helpful for both Tenants, offering documentation that they timely submitted payments to the Landlord, and Landlords, giving them a method to track incoming payments and monitor late payments or bounced checks.
